在Linux环境下进行反汇编指令的性能测试,通常涉及以下几个步骤:
objdump
、readelf
等工具来反汇编二进制文件。perf
、gprof
等性能分析工具来测量和分析反汇编代码的执行时间。objdump
或readelf
进行反汇编,并将结果保存到文件中。perf
或gprof
来运行反汇编后的代码,并收集性能数据。perf report
、gprof
报告或其他可视化工具来分析性能数据。请注意,性能测试的结果可能受到多种因素的影响,包括硬件配置、操作系统版本、编译器版本等。因此,在进行性能测试时,最好在相同的环境中进行多次测试以获得更可靠的结果。
此外,对于特定的应用场景,可能还需要考虑其他因素,如内存访问模式、分支预测准确性等。这些因素都可能对反汇编指令的性能产生影响。